Output 2bf962b91b3ada17def06e6be3aa225e1beec3daa6563f4eaa55a42aed498a1b:2

value
22226338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a642ef5f88c2597de7121675624977e323957a7 OP_EQUAL
address
MHbhsdbK31d2sbDSeXiboh5cGDKhqkXxXm
transaction
2bf962b91b3ada17def06e6be3aa225e1beec3daa6563f4eaa55a42aed498a1b
spent
true